Every outdoor sign in Wauchula is governed by the municipality’s sign ordinance, which sets how large a sign may be, how tall it may stand, how far it must sit from the property line, whether it may be illuminated, and which sign types are permitted in each zoning district. This page summarizes those requirements in plain language and links each value back to the section of the Wauchula code it came from.
Sign rules here are layered. The base zoning district — commercial, industrial, or residential — sets the default limits, and overlay districts such as historic or downtown districts can tighten them further. Because the most specific jurisdiction controls, a freestanding monument sign on a commercial parcel and a wall sign in a historic overlay can face very different limits even on the same street in Wauchula.

Before you order or install a sign in Wauchula, confirm three things: the maximum sign area and height allowed in the parcel’s zoning district, the minimum setback from the right-of-way, and whether the sign type you want — freestanding, monument, wall, projecting, or awning — is permitted there at all. Many permit denials come from missing a setback or an overlay-district restriction rather than from the size of the sign itself, so checking the governing section before applying saves a costly resubmittal.

Design Standards For Under Canopy Sign Maximum Area
Signs mounted under a canopy, awning, or awning-like structure shall be a maximum of four square feet in size, shall maintain a clearance of seven feet from the bottom of the sign to the top of the walkway beneath, and shall swing freely.
Building Permit Issued Prior To Effective Date Definition
Building permit issued prior to effective date: Any building, structure, or sign for which a lawful Building Permit is issued or for which a complete Building Permit or Sign Permit application as determined by the Building Official or Development Director has been filed at least one day prior to the effective date of this code, may be constructed and completed in conformance with the permit and other applicable approvals, permits, and conditions, even if such building, structure, or sign does not fully comply with this code.

Signs And Advertising Prohibition
The use of any portion of a communications tower for sign or advertising purposes including, without limitation, company name, banners, or streamers, is prohibited.
